I logged a ticket with WPML that has been escalated to their compatibility team. They advise me to mention this to you, and ask for further support.
At WPML i called the ticket “Invalid login language switching”, and it has been treated by one Shekhar Bhandari.
The issue : on http://184.108.40.206/heinpoblome/
go to another language than english;
go to the ‘my login’ page (‘mon profil’ in french or ‘mijn login’ in dutch);
login with a non-existant user;
the page will switch to the ENGLISH invalid login page;
This is when WPML diagnosed this as a compatibility issue. I will also log this ticket with Formidable, since there does not seem to be a clear ‘culprit’.
there seems to be another dimension to this problem, regarding language switching and widgets.
when i put the Formidable shortcode in a text box on a page, the language switching works properly; I just mean the language switching of the page that shows the login shortcode; i am not referring to what happens when logging in with a unknown user mentioned above.
when i put the shortcode into a widget on a page, the language switching does not work anymore.